Introduction
Dans le monde du développement logiciel, la fiabilité du code est primordiale, surtout lorsque l'on touche à des domaines sensibles comme les mathématiques de pointe ou les logiciels critiques pour la mission. Leanstral, le nouvel agent de code open-source pour Lean 4, est là pour relever ce défi. Conçu pour optimiser l'ingénierie de preuve, Leanstral promet de transformer la façon dont nous abordons le codage formel et la vérification des preuves.
Qu'est-ce que Leanstral ?
Leanstral est le premier agent open-source conçu spécifiquement pour Lean 4, un assistant de preuve capable d'exprimer des objets mathématiques complexes et des spécifications logicielles. Contrairement aux systèmes de preuve existants qui se contentent de traiter des problèmes mathématiques isolés, Leanstral est optimisé pour fonctionner dans des dépôts formels réalistes, rendant le processus de vérification non seulement plus rapide mais aussi plus fiable.
Pourquoi l'Open-Source Est Important
En publiant Leanstral sous licence Apache 2.0, Mistral AI démocratise l'accès à un outil puissant qui peut être intégré et adapté selon les besoins des développeurs. Cette ouverture encourage l'innovation, permettant aux développeurs d'améliorer et de personnaliser l'outil sans restrictions coûteuses imposées par des solutions propriétaires.
Efficacité et Performance
Leanstral utilise une architecture hautement sparse et est optimisé pour les tâches d'ingénierie de preuve. Grâce à son entraînement spécifique avec le lean-lsp-mcp, Leanstral offre des performances exceptionnelles par rapport à ses concurrents, tout en restant économiquement viable. Son architecture permet une inférence parallèle, ce qui en fait un choix performant et rentable pour les entreprises souhaitant automatiser leurs processus de vérification.
Comparaison avec d'Autres Modèles
Lors des benchmarks, Leanstral a démontré un avantage significatif en termes d'efficacité par rapport à ses pairs open-source plus volumineux. Par exemple, alors que des modèles comme GLM5-744B-A40B plafonnent dans leurs scores FLTEval, Leanstral surpasse ces modèles en une seule passe, prouvant ainsi sa capacité à gérer des tâches complexes de manière efficace.
Cas d'Usage Concrets
Prenons l'exemple d'une startup dans le domaine de la fintech qui a besoin de vérifier la sécurité et la conformité de ses algorithmes de trading. En utilisant Leanstral, elle peut non seulement générer des preuves formelles de la robustesse de ses systèmes, mais aussi s'assurer que chaque mise à jour logicielle respecte les spécifications requises sans nécessiter de revue humaine exhaustive.
L'Avenir avec Leanstral
Leanstral n'est pas seulement un outil pour aujourd'hui; il est conçu pour évoluer avec les besoins futurs de l'industrie. Grâce à sa capacité à intégrer des MCP arbitraires, Leanstral s'adapte facilement aux nouvelles exigences et innovations, garantissant ainsi sa pertinence à long terme.
Conclusion
En définitive, Leanstral représente une avancée majeure pour l'ingénierie de preuve formelle et le codage fiable. Pour les entrepreneurs et les développeurs, il offre une solution open-source puissante, adaptée et capable de transformer leurs opérations.
Tu veux automatiser tes opérations avec l'IA ? Réserve un call de 15 min pour en discuter.
